Overview
TB-500 is a synthetic peptide that copies the active region of thymosin beta-4, a natural protein that controls how cells build and move their internal skeleton. Most TB-500 products reproduce the short LKKTETQ sequence (residues 17 to 23) responsible for binding actin and driving cell migration, which is why it gets marketed for tendon, muscle, and wound repair. There are essentially no completed human trials of the TB-500 fragment itself; almost all human clinical data is for the full-length thymosin beta-4 molecule.
